Why it happens

China has a psychological support hotline, 12320-5 in some regions; embassies and insurers can connect you to English help.

Fastest fix, free: Call the mental health hotline, 12320-5, your embassy, or travel insurance for support.
Last verified: 2026-09-20 · Confidence: Multiple sources (pending first-hand verification)
The full fix sequence (free)
  1. Call a mental health hotline, 12320-5.
  2. Contact your embassy for English counselors.
  3. Call your travel insurance.
  4. Go to a hospital ER if in immediate danger.

If nothing works

If hotlines are busy:

  1. Message a friend or family member.
  2. Use a translation app to explain.
  3. Go to any hospital and ask for help.
